Earlier this week in the East Indian village of West Bengal, a millennial phenomenom occurred when a baby was born with 4 arms and 4 legs. Thousands of residents in the eastern part India have been visiting the hospital as they have dubbed the child ‘God Baby’. The nickname stems from the appearance of the Hindu God Brahma, which has multiple limbs. According to USA Today, the the chairman of the department of obstetrics and gynecology at Hackensack University Medical Center stated that this birth is actually the result of a “parasitic twin”. Similar to conjoined twins, which are two living fetuses attached to each other. In this instance, one of the twins never fully develops, causing it to be encased in the other fetus.

The scene at the hospital has gotten a bit chaotic as police were called to control the crowd filled with crying and praying villagers.
